New Biomass Collaboration Aims to Transform European Energy Landscape

AABENRAA, DENMARK – In a major development for the European biomass sector, GlobalFund Trading Xchange (GFTx) and the EnstedHavn Bulk Terminal in Aabenraa, Denmark, have announced a strategic partnership that aligns with governmental efforts to foster a sustainable biomass industry. The GFTxBiomass Strategy (GBS) 2023 initiative is poised to make a significant contribution to sustainable energy practices, leveraging biomass to meet the European Union’s growing demand for renewable energy.

The collaboration underscores a growing commitment across Europe to develop renewable energy sources that can reduce carbon emissions and help the EU achieve its ambitious sustainability goals. Biomass energy, derived from agricultural residues, agro-industrial waste, and woody biomass, is at the forefront of this shift. The GBS 2023 initiative estimates that ASEAN Biomass feedstock could reach approximately 230 million tons annually, marking a significant step towards reducing reliance on fossil fuels.

The European Union is actively working towards creating a sustainable, circular bio-based economy, despite facing significant environmental challenges, especially in the forestry and agriculture sectors. Biomass currently accounts for nearly 60% of the EU’s renewable energy sources, a figure that is expected to grow if it continues to meet strict sustainability criteria.

The partnership between GFTx and EnstedHavn aims to address some of these challenges by providing innovative logistics solutions and developing a comprehensive value chain for the biomass industry. This initiative not only supports the government’s sustainability efforts but also promises to enhance the role of biomass in the energy transition.

Key Highlights of the GBS 2023 Initiative:

  • Government Support: The initiative aligns with the Danish government’s strategy, showcasing a unified approach to boosting the biomass sector and promoting sustainable energy practices.
  • Regional Hub Development: EnstedHavn is set to become the first Regional Biomass and Grain Hub for the ASEAN-EU Super Corridor, facilitating the efficient movement of biomass resources and enhancing trade efficiency.
  • Sustainable Energy: Recognizing biomass energy’s role in reducing CO2 emissions, the partnership aims to contribute to meeting the EU’s renewable energy targets.
  • Innovative Logistics: With state-of-the-art port handling services, EnstedHavn aims to ensure a smooth flow of biomass resources, positioning Denmark as a key player in the global biomass trade.

Experts in the field commend the partnership for its potential to set new standards in sustainability, efficiency, and innovation within the biomass logistics sector. This collaboration between GlobalFund Trading Xchange and EnstedHavn represents a significant milestone in Europe’s journey towards a more sustainable and renewable energy future, reflecting a broader global trend towards environmental responsibility and energy transition.
